//! Block import benchmark.
|
|
//!
|
|
//! This benchmark is expected to measure block import operation of
|
|
//! some more or less full block.
|
|
//!
|
|
//! As we also want to protect against cold-cache attacks, this
|
|
//! benchmark should not rely on any caching (except those that
|
|
//! DO NOT depend on user input). Thus block generation should be
|
|
//! based on randomized operation.
|
|
//!
|
|
//! This is supposed to be very simple benchmark and is not subject
|
|
//! to much configuring - just block full of randomized transactions.
|
|
//! It is not supposed to measure runtime modules weight correctness
